Original Description
Muirhead Bone’s Near the Spanish Steps, Rome is a masterful drypoint etching that captures the timeless charm of Rome’s iconic Spanish Steps with remarkable precision and atmosphere. Created in the early 20th century, Bone’s work embodies the delicate interplay of light and shadow, rendering the historic architecture and bustling street life with exquisite detail. As one of Britain’s foremost etchers, Bone’s technical skill shines through in the intricate lines and subtle tonal variations, evoking a sense of grandeur and intimacy simultaneously. The composition balances the monumental stairway with the human energy of passersby, reflecting his keen observational eye. This piece holds significance in art history as a testament to Bone’s role in reviving printmaking as a fine art medium, bridging traditional craftsmanship with modern sensibility. Its atmospheric quality places it within the lineage of Romantic topographical art, yet its crisp execution aligns with early 20th-century realism.
